Definition of Active and Passive Voice:
·
Active Voice: The subject performs the action of the verb.
·
Example:
She is cooking up stories so that she can escape punishment.
·
Passive Voice: The object of the active sentence becomes the subject, and the verb is changed to its past participle (V3) form.
·
Example:
Stories are being cooked up by her so that punishment can be escaped.
Explanation:
The given sentence is in
active voice:
"She is cooking up stories so that she can escape punishment."
To change it to
passive voice, follow these steps:
1.
Identify Subject, Verb, and Object:
·
Subject: She
·
Verb: is cooking up
·
Object: stories
2.
Convert Verb Form (Active → Passive):
· "is cooking up" changes to "are being cooked up"
3.
Rewrite in Passive Structure:
·
Passive: "Stories are being cooked up by her so that punishment can be escaped."
Grammatical Rule Used:
Active Structure:
Subject + is/am/are + V1+ing + Object
Passive Structure:
Object + is/am/are + being + past participle (V3) + by + Subject
